How much do flex position j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for flex position in Colorado is $18.29,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.20 and $21.01 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a flex position?

Flex positions are jobs that offer flexible work arrangements, allowing employees to adjust their schedules, work locations, or hours to better fit their personal needs. These roles can include part-time work, remote work, compressed workweeks, or jobs with variable hours. Flex positions are popular among people seeking work-life balance, students, caregivers, or those with other commitments. Employers offer these roles to attract a wider range of talent and to increase employee satisfaction and productivity.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a flex position?

To thrive in a Flex Position, you need a versatile skill set that often includes adaptability, time management, and proficiency in the core functions of the assigned department, along with a relevant educational background. Familiarity with common office software, scheduling systems, or industry-specific tools is typically required, depending on the nature of each assignment. Strong communication, problem-solving, and teamwork skills help you quickly integrate into new teams and tasks. These abilities are crucial for meeting variable workplace demands and ensuring seamless transitions between roles or departments.

What are some common challenges faced in a flex position and how can they be managed?

In a flex position, one of the biggest challenges is adapting quickly to shifting priorities and tasks, as assignments may change based on company needs. Flex employees often need to balance multiple projects or departments, requiring strong time management and communication skills. It’s helpful to stay organized, proactively seek feedback, and clarify expectations with supervisors to ensure priorities are aligned. Building relationships across teams can also ease transitions and foster a supportive work environment.

What is the difference between Flex Position vs Part-Time Worker?

AspectFlex PositionPart-Time Worker
Work HoursFlexible, varies based on needsFixed, limited hours per week
CredentialsTypically no specific credentials requiredMay require basic qualifications or certifications
Work EnvironmentCan be in various settings, often project-basedUsually in retail, hospitality, or office settings
Employer UsageUsed for temporary, on-demand staffingUsed for consistent, part-time employment

Flex Positions offer adaptable scheduling without fixed hours, suitable for project-based or on-demand work. Part-Time Workers have set hours, often in retail or service industries, providing consistent but limited employment.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find roles that match their availability and career goals.
